pub mod github;
pub mod hooks;
use crate::error::Result;
use crate::models::{Critique, Problem};
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Eq)]
pub enum ReviewState {
Approved,
ChangesRequested,
Commented,
Dismissed,
}
#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
pub struct ReviewInfo {
pub id: u64,
pub author: String,
pub state: ReviewState,
pub body: String,
}
#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
pub struct ReviewThread {
pub comment_id: u64,
pub author: String,
pub body: String,
pub path: String,
pub line: Option<usize>,
pub is_resolved: bool,
pub is_outdated: bool,
}
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Eq)]
pub enum PrStatus {
Open,
Merged,
Closed,
}
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Eq)]
pub enum IssueStatus {
Open,
Closed,
}
pub trait SyncProvider {
fn name(&self) -> &str;
fn check_auth(&self) -> Result<String>;
fn detect_repo(&self) -> Result<(String, String)>;
fn import_issue(&self, number: u64) -> Result<Problem>;
fn list_unlinked_issues(
&self,
existing: &[(String, u64)],
label: Option<&str>,
) -> Result<Vec<(u64, String)>>;
fn create_issue(&self, problem: &Problem) -> Result<u64>;
fn create_pr(
&self,
solution: &crate::models::Solution,
problem: &Problem,
branch: &str,
) -> Result<u64>;
fn merge_pr(&self, number: u64) -> Result<()>;
fn close_issue(&self, number: u64) -> Result<()>;
fn reopen_issue(&self, number: u64) -> Result<()>;
fn pull_reviews(&self, pr_number: u64) -> Result<Vec<ReviewInfo>>;
fn pull_review_threads(&self, pr_number: u64) -> Result<Vec<ReviewThread>> {
let _ = pr_number;
Ok(vec![])
}
fn pr_status(&self, pr_number: u64) -> Result<PrStatus>;
fn issue_status(&self, number: u64) -> Result<IssueStatus>;
}
fn review_title(author: &str, body: &str) -> String {
let first_line = body.lines().next().unwrap_or("").trim();
if first_line.len() > 5 {
let truncated: String = first_line.chars().take(80).collect();
format!("@{}: {}", author, truncated)
} else {
format!("GitHub review from @{}", author)
}
}
pub fn review_to_critique(review: &ReviewInfo, solution_id: &str, critique_id: String) -> Critique {
let mut critique = Critique::new(
critique_id,
review_title(&review.author, &review.body),
solution_id.to_string(),
);
critique.author = Some(review.author.clone());
critique.argument = review.body.clone();
critique.github_review_id = Some(review.id);
match review.state {
ReviewState::ChangesRequested => {
critique.severity = crate::models::CritiqueSeverity::High;
}
ReviewState::Commented => {
critique.severity = crate::models::CritiqueSeverity::Medium;
}
_ => {}
}
critique
}
pub fn thread_to_critique(
thread: &ReviewThread,
solution_id: &str,
critique_id: String,
) -> Critique {
let mut critique = Critique::new(
critique_id,
review_title(&thread.author, &thread.body),
solution_id.to_string(),
);
critique.author = Some(thread.author.clone());
critique.argument = thread.body.clone();
critique.github_review_id = Some(thread.comment_id);
if !thread.path.is_empty() {
critique.file_path = Some(thread.path.clone());
critique.line_start = thread.line;
critique.line_end = thread.line;
}
if thread.is_outdated {
critique.argument = format!(
"{}\n\nNote: this comment is on an outdated diff hunk.",
critique.argument
);
}
critique
}
